Indians take to the streets of Kuala Lumpur

November 26, 2007
Ethnic Indians are the second largest minority in Malaysia, following the Chinese, and are also among the most underprivileged with two-thirds of the Indian community living in poverty. Sunday's rally was the largest seen in Malaysia in the last decade involving ethnic Indians.

A similar protest was carried out in Kuala Lumpur on November 10, with thousands taking to the streets and demanding electoral reforms. The police used similar force to disperse the crowds in that rally which lasted only a few hours.


Photo caption: Protesters run for cover as Malaysian riot police fire tear gas during a demonstration by ethnic Indians in Kuala Lumpur on Sunday.
